NOTICE TO SUBSCEIBEBS xnceease’Tn peice of “GUARDIAN." ON and AFTER MONDAY, 2nd APEIL-, 1917, the price of the Guaedian will be TWOPENCE per copy. At the late General Meeting of the New Zealand Newspaper Proprietors’ Association it was unanimously decided that an increase in the Selling Price of Newspapers was necessary owing to the heavy advance in tho landed cost of News Printing Paper and the increased cost of Newspaper production generally, due to conditions arising out of the war.
